Patriots Set AFC Title Game at Broncos as Bills Fire McDermott After OT Exit

Denver turns to Jarrett Stidham after Bo Nix’s broken ankle.

Overview

  • The Patriots beat the Texans 28-16 in snow and rain, forcing eight total turnovers to reach their first conference final since the Brady era.
  • Denver edged Buffalo 33-30 in overtime, with the Bills committing five turnovers and Ja’Quan McMillian wrestling away a late interception that set up the winning drive.
  • Broncos coach Sean Payton confirmed Bo Nix sustained a broken ankle and will miss the rest of the playoffs, with Jarrett Stidham named the AFC Championship starter and Sam Ehlinger the backup.
  • Two days after the loss, the Bills dismissed head coach Sean McDermott and elevated GM Brandon Beane to president of football operations, with owner Terry Pegula calling for a new leadership structure.
  • Josh Allen, who accounted for four turnovers, said he felt he let his teammates down as Buffalo’s season ended with a fourth Divisional Round exit in five years.
